Software Program Testing: Reactive Vs Proactive

Date : April 15, 2025

Might you check all six of these conditions by way of black field testing, more than likely not. The test strategy is the begin line for planning the test process, for selecting the take a look at design strategies and test varieties to be applied, and for outlining the entry and exit standards. Cap off these test approach finest practices with impeccable imitation between the developer environment and the end-user environment. Maintain traceability in test instances, necessities, and take a look at outcomes and establish a traceability matrix linking all requirements to their corresponding take a look at case and end result.

This examine sought to establish elements from students’ perceptions and the system usability suggestions to combine it right into a conceptual framework to boost the implementation of mobile invigilation functions in greater education. The study, subsequently, adopted a mixed-method, convergent parallel strategy, depicted within the flowchart in Fig. four, to determine the weather for inclusion in a novel conceptual framework for profitable implementation. The nature of the social phenomenon calls for various inquiries and, due to this fact, contains quantitative and qualitative explorations. The combined methodology steps followed embody stating the research aims, information collection, evaluation, merging of results and interpretation of merged results for the quantitative and qualitative parts.

  • The quantitative outcomes section provides solutions relating to the system usability of the invigilation app throughout a digital evaluation as a half of the quantitative evaluation of the mixed-method study.
  • Part testing, also referred to as unit, module, and program testing, searches for defects in and verifies the functioning of software (e.g., modules, programs, objects, lessons, and so on.) that are individually testable.
  • You must select testing methods with an eye fixed towards the components mentioned earlier, the schedule, price range, and feature constraints of the project and the realities of the group and its politics.
  • Institutions ought to prioritise creating an environment where students feel comfortable with invigilation know-how prior to high-stakes assessments.

Aligned with Agile principles, this strategy integrates testing into the development lifecycle, selling steady feedback and speedy adaptation. This strategy prioritizes testing efforts primarily based on the potential threat of failure and its impression on the enterprise. Elevated stakeholder involvement leads to the development and implementation of a successful test approach.

The constructs from the TAM referring to PU, PEoU and Att have been labelled as overarching deductive themes and the student perceptions as identified by Marano et al. (2023), have been used as deductive classes. Student responses to the four open-ended questions on the Google Varieties, had been inserted into ATLAS.ti™ computer-aided qualitative knowledge analysis software program (CAQDAS). The 128 pupil responses have been analysed by making use of the fixed comparative methodology (CCM), as described by Boeije (2002), which includes the creation of meaning items, indicating a specific idea that may stand on its own.

Standards Compliant Take A Look At Strategies

reactive testing approach

Take A Look At managers must ponder over components similar to consumer and stakeholder input, the newest updates, and newly-found defects which may call for some last moment changes. Incorporating flexibility into your workforce will help the complete testing to enhance on par with the evolutionary nature of modern necessities. So, listed under are some really helpful actions testers can take to considerably enhance the efficiency, high quality, and implementation of a check method. Testers also wants to think about the reusability and scalability of test information to ensure straightforward expansion and modification with evolving testing necessities.

During the CCM, every which means unit is analysed and in comparison with new and present knowledge, constantly including and categorising the which means items (Boeije 2002). The CCM implies a deductive-inductive strategy the place students’ open-ended responses had been analysed in the course of the coding course of (Boeije 2002). In this regard, the inductively created new that means items were categorised under the conceptual framework’s deductive classes. Throughout the coding course of, an inductive category of preparation performed was created, with quite a few new codes identified and linked to this class. To guarantee scientific rigour, the researcher developed a codebook through the analysis process based on the procedures explained by DeCuir-Gunby et al. (2011).

On the opposite hand, if the team needs to gain some confidence that the software can address frequent operational tasks, use circumstances are the way in which to go. You can opt for structure-based techniques and other detailed and rigorous testing approaches if the target requires thorough testing. The complete testing group uses their important thinking, creativity, and area expertise to identify the scope of improvement, discover attainable natural language processing scenarios, and simulate person conduct.

reactive testing approach

Individual Considerations Category

The qualitative and quantitative knowledge collection occurred simultaneously, while the evaluation was carried out separately (Creswell and Plano Clark 2011). The qualitative results supply a novel perspective and a comprehensive understanding of pupil perceptions of a cell invigilation app throughout online assessments. In this regard, the merging of the qualitative results contributes to and expands the TAM as an current theoretical framework for technology adoption within this specific mobile invigilation software usage (Fig. 10). The lecturers approached the implementation of the invigilator app pragmatically and scaffolded the students’ publicity to changing into accustomed to the app. In this regard, communication on the future implementation of the app during assessments commenced before the semester module started. Real-time entry to support safeguards students from struggling without technical assist.

Check boundary circumstances on, under and above the edges of input and output equivalence lessons. For occasion, let say a bank utility where you’ll find a way to withdraw maximum Rs.20,000 and a minimal of Rs.one hundred, so in boundary worth testing we take a look at solely the precise boundaries, somewhat than hitting in the middle. Is it actually a take a look at when you put some inputs into some software, however never look to see whether the software program produces the right result? The essence of testing is to examine whether or not the software produces the right result and to strive this, and we should evaluate what the software produces to what it ought to produce. Re-testing ensures the original fault has been eliminated; regression testing seems for surprising unwanted effects.

And till this black field of business logic is totally white box tested, then the opportunity for a savings to checking transfer to carry out incorrectly is reactively high. The check strategy is the implementation of the test strategy for a particular project. The process-oriented method focuses on aligning testing actions with well-defined processes and standards.

Testers also can trace check cases back to set necessities and determine how any modifications impact the models https://www.globalcloudteam.com/. Primarily Based on testing goals and project requirements, your team can use one or a combination of the below-mentioned strategies. The extra a check surroundings is just like the production environment, the upper the reliability and accuracy of take a look at outcomes.

For instance, analytical test strategies contain upfront evaluation of the test basis, and tend to determine issues in the take a look at basis prior to test execution. An analytical check technique is the most typical technique, it may be based on requirements (in consumer acceptance testing, for example), specs (in system or component testing), or risks (in a proper risk-based testing strategy). If the fatally bugged source code is introduced into the production environment, the fallout could possibly be catastrophic. The greater the percentage of code being examined is immediately proportional to how proactive you’re in totally testing your supply code.

Testers can easily outline goals, the scope of testing, and anticipated outcomes through a testing approach. Some other parameters that come under the definition of take a look at strategy embody check information necessities, take a look at environment, and the roles and duties of different team members in the testing staff. The National Institute of Standards and Technology (NIST) found that fixing a bug during design is 10 times cheaper than fixing it post-release. A 2023 survey by TechBeacon confirmed 68% of dev teams use a mixture – proactive exams for core techniques, reactive ones when surprises pop up.

To avoid confusion whereas deciding on a test approach or technique, it is important to consider a list of various elements while making a selection. Testers additionally seek the assistance of the stakeholders for clarifying ambiguities, validating requirements, and gathering feedback on totally different test circumstances and check outcomes, leading to larger transparency and assembly all the required project wants. The process begins with a detailed analysis of check knowledge that identifies tendencies, patents, and anomalies. Testers achieve useful insights into system habits through the use of visualization, information mining, and statistical analysis.

Then comes understanding the supposed software program functionality by analyzing use instances reactive test strategy and consumer stories and addressing gaps and ambiguities with the assistance of clarifications and suggestions loops. The ultimate step is to document these necessities and create a traceability matrix to enable adequate check protection and pave the trail toward developing an efficient check approach. Since implementing a well-defined testing strategy acts as a backbone of a Software Testing Life Cycle, the preparations have to be top-notch. But by totally preparing for creating and implementing a testing method, professionals lay out a sturdy foundation and increase the possibilities of their testing efforts.

Search

Categories

Форекс Обучение

4

Финтех

3

Uncategorized

41

Software development

4

Sober living

1

News

3

IT Образование

4

IT Вакансії

3

Bookkeeping

1

ai sales bot 4

2

9600_prod3

1

2

3

10200_sat2

2

! Без рубрики

3

Latest Posts

1Red Casino: Online Casino Spelen Met Betrouwbaarheid in het Nederlands

April 19, 2025

Project Manager: Кто Это, Чем Он Занимается И Как Стать Менеджером Проектов Профклик

April 18, 2025

Мотивация Сотрудников В Организации: Методы И Инструменты, Современные Подходы Hr-платформа Моякоманда

April 18, 2025

C++ Точка Входа В Программу Stack Overflow На Русском

April 18, 2025

Какого Цвета Ваш Бизнес? Офтоп На Vc Ru

April 18, 2025

Слот-машины автоматы в интернет казино-сайтах с акциями

April 18, 2025

Client's Testimonials

Absolutely amazed by the transformation! Our property went from bare to captivating in a snap. The buyers were equally captivated, and we closed the deal swiftly. Thank you for making it happen!
- Sarah T -
Your virtual staging brought magic to our listings. The attention to detail and quality truly set us apart. Clients were impressed, and we had offers pouring in sooner than we expected.
- Mark S -
Unlimited revisions made all the difference. Your team's dedication and creative flair exceeded our expectations. With your expertise, we achieved perfection. Highly recommended!
- Emily L -
The smooth process was a lifesaver. Responsive support at every turn and hassle-free assistance took the stress out of staging. Buyers connected with the spaces, and it made all the difference."
- Alex M -
Your pay-on-satisfaction model instilled trust. The results were beyond our hopes, and we happily paid for your top-tier service. Your staging was the secret to making our properties shine.
- Jessica H -
Seeing our vision brought to life was surreal. Your expert staging made buyers fall in love instantly. With properties selling quicker, our reputation skyrocketed. A true game-changer!
- David P -